Overall Objective
![](https://plomeproject.es/wp-content/uploads/2022/02/StrategicPLOME-01-948x1024.png)
The overall objective of the PLOME project is to design, develop and validate several key aspects that will enable the proposed concept. To do so, 7 objectives will be tackled:
-
-
-
- O.1: To design a framework for deep-sea marine monitoring with a platform of fixed and mobile systems.
- O.2: To develop technological capabilities to enable the prolonged deployment of AUVs at deep-sea for marine observation
- O.3: To develop interconnected long-lasting stand-alone stations as a strategic multiparametric platform for continuous ecosystem monitoring.
- O.4: To develop an effective communication strategy combining heterogeneous technologies for the operation of the different deployed systems.
- O.5: To develop techniques for processing and analyzing different kinds of marine data gathered from mobile and fixed stations.
- O.6: To conduct demonstrations of the overall PLOME concept and new developments in real operational scenarios
- O.7: To disseminate the project outcomes to target audiences and key stakeholders, including policymakers, and ensure that the results live on in the research community and in a commercial context.
